This store was FANTASTIC. The girl who runs it is such a great help. If there is something you don't like about the dress, she will work with you to fix it. The prices are amazing. I bought my dress AND veil for $701.00 and that was not on sale. They also carry bridesmaid dresses, and have books of invitation samples that you can order.
If you order more than three bridesmaid dresses, you get a 10% discount which may not seem like much, however, I had one of my bridesmaids try on a dress here, which was priced at $130, and when we went to check out another store, it was $250.
Also I haven't had my alterations done, but when I was there trying on my dress, another girl told me that she found a dress that was a size 10 and Mylee made it into a 0 for her. So I completely trust her with my alterations.

Cochrane Ranchehouse is a hertiage building located in Cochrane, Alberta. It has various rooms to choose from, but we rented the Heritage Hall and Chinook Dining room. Heritage Hall has a stone fireplace which is just beautiful. The venue can be used as a ceremony site both inside and outside if weather permits. The event coordinators were fantastic, answered all my questions.
The only problem I had, was that they don't tell you that you can only book 18 months in advance, while non profit groups can book 2 years in advance. So I had to change my wedding date three times to get one that fit with the venue.
Also, you are limited in your choice of caterer as you much choose one that is on the supplied list.
You are not allowed candles at this venue.
